BU2 Thermal and Fluid System

The activities of the former business units “Filtration and Engine Peripherals” and “Thermal Management” will be merged in the new business unit “Thermal and Fluid Systems”. Here, thermal management will be able to access production competencies in filtration developed within the group over many years, enabling it to place competitive future-oriented technologies on the market. MAHLE is committed to thermal management and intends to continue growth in this area.

Your Contribution

  • Lead development of EE components of thermal management system, such as BLDC, pump & actuator
  • Make the specifications & DVPR for the EE components
  • Lead the technical review of the EE components and supplier evaluation
  • Create DFMEA, PFEMA and process documentations
  • Build prototypes with SW & SYS, set up test bench and evaluate products
  • Create design documentation and test report in PLM system
  • Definition and development of validation plan for both internal and external validations
  • Support predevelopment & serial projects of internal and external entities

 

Your Experience & Qualification:

  • Bachelor’s degree or above in electrical engineering or comparable major
  • Min. 5 years of design experience in automotive electronics/hardware
  • Deep understanding of analog and digital circuit
  • Familiar with Stepper/BLDC Motor control circuit, LIN/CAN interfaces
  • Familiar with validation, process
  • Familiar with PLM tool will be a plus.
  • Good knowledge of Automotive standards
